Mexican-American Oral History Project: Interview with Antonio Morales
|
| Description | BIOGRAPHICAL INFORMATION: Antonio Morales, one of nine children, was born in 1934 in San Antonio, Texas, and moved to the Blooming Prairie, Minnnesota area with his family in 1947. Married in 1952, he and his wife, Genevive, have eight children. SUBJECTS DISCUSSED: His independent trucking business; his family; working in the fields in southern Minnesota; his philosophy in raising children; and continuing the Mexican heritage. |
